扩音机功放电路的改进研究

摘    要:原有功放电路多采用OCL电路,具有工作性能稳定,动态范围大、动态感强,音质好等优点,但是,该电路也存在着不足之处,一旦一只功放管被损坏,就会扩大故障范围,使整个功放电路不能正常工作,本文通过对原有功放电路的分析,在电路上对原有功放电路进行改进,可以达到弥补、优化原功放电路的目的。

关 键 词:OCL电路  功率放大电路  并联推挽功率放大电路  扩音机  功放电路

An improvement of the power amplification circuit of audio power amplifier

Abstract:The former power amplification circuit usually adopts OCL amplifier,which has stationary working condition,a large dynamic range scope,a good feeling in dynamic condition, good tone quatity and so on .But it has also some defects.When one power amplifier transistor is damaged,it will enlarge the scope of the fault and make the whole circuit not working normally. This article improves the former power amplification circuit .The improved circuit can not only remedy the defect of the former but make it better.
Keywords:OCL amplifier  power  amplification circuit  parallel push  pull power amplification
